On Wed, Mar 28, 2007 at 03:11:02PM +0100, baz wrote: > I'm trying to install M S true type fonts on Edgy but when I type, > sudo apt-get install msttcorefonts > > I get, > Package msttcorefonts is not available, but is referred to by another > package. > This may mean that the package is missing, has been obsoleted, or > is only available from another source > E: Package msttcorefonts has no installation candidate > > Where am I going wrong here? >
You don't have the multiverse repository enabled? System --> Administration --> Software Preferences. Enable multiverse, try again. Cheers, Al. -- ubuntu-uk@lists.ubuntu.com https://lists.ubuntu.com/mailman/listinfo/ubuntu-uk https://wiki.kubuntu.org/UKTeam/
